Social Search® Results: places near Houston, TX (0.015 secs)

Akari Energy

Plumbing Contractors

811 Dallas St
Houston, TX 77002
Contact info

Rating: 5.0 1 review

Read Reviews
Write a Review

Freedom Solar Power - Houston Solar Panel Company & Installers

Solar Energy Systems Contractors

1212 N Post Oak Rd
Houston, TX 77055
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review



Schneider Electric

Solar Energy Equip & Systems Service & Repair

14400 Hollister St
Houston, TX 77066
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

EnerWisely

Solar Energy Equip & Systems Service & Repair


Houston, TX 77042
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

TEXAS SOLAR OASIS

Solar Energy Designers & Consultants


Houston, TX 77015
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

Schneider Electric

Solar Energy Equip & Systems Service & Repair

3433 North Sam Houston Parkway West
Houston, TX 77086
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

Schneider Electric

Solar Energy Equip & Systems Service & Repair

10900 Equity Drive
Houston, TX 77041
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

Schneider Electric

Solar Energy Equip & Systems Service & Repair

12121 Wickchester Lane
Houston, TX 77079
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

Sol City Energy

Solar Heating Contractors

13201 Northwest Fwy
Houston, TX 77040
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

METRO Solar Panel Installation & Repair

Solar Heating Contractors

2800 Post Oak Blvd Ste 4100
Houston, TX 77056
Contact info

Rating: N/A 0 review

Read Reviews
Write a Review

prev 1 2 next >>